Prairie dogs are America__APOS__s answer to the meerkat - small, sociable and exceptionally cute. This offbeat film narrated by Rob Brydon takes us to the Wild West where prairie dogs live in huge colonies known as __APOS__towns__APOS__. Like meerkats, they are comical to watch, but there is a whole lot more to prairie dogs than just being cute - they can talk.
For 30 years Professor Con Slobodchikoff has been recording their calls in response to predators like coyotes, hawks and badgers. He believes he has discovered a language second only to humans in its complexity. It__APOS__s a bold claim but is he right? Con has devised a series of cunning field experiments to help prove his point.
